#783296 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#783296 is composed of 47.1% red, 19.6%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 282 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 39.2%. #783296 color hex could be obtained by blending #f064ff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#783296 color description : Dark moderate violet.

#783296 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#783296 has RGB values of R:120, G:50,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7877270.

Shades and Tints of #783296

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f9f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#783296

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666068 is the less saturated color, while #8a04c4 is the most saturated one.
